2026 Seattle City Council Set with Affordable Housing Champion Lin Victory in District 2

Seattle, WALocal News

Lin Victory is set to join the Seattle City Council, advocating for affordable housing in District 2 after a decisive election outcome. Her campaign resonated with voters concerned about the escalating cost of living and housing shortages in the city. Victory's focus on affordable housing reflects a growing urgency among Seattle residents for solutions that address these issues. The election results signal a potential shift in local policy, emphasizing housing accessibility and community needs. This trend mirrors national conversations around urban housing challenges, as cities grapple with similar issues.

Victory's plans include collaboration with local organizations to develop sustainable housing initiatives. Her commitment to addressing affordable housing will be closely watched as she takes office. The council's new composition may influence broader strategies to enhance housing policies in Seattle.
